为什么excel不自动求和


在日常使用电子表格软件时,自动求和功能是许多用户依赖的高效工具,但偶尔会出现无法正常工作的状况。这并非软件缺陷,而往往源于多种因素的综合影响。本文将从专业角度,系统分析为什么Excel不自动求和,并结合官方文档和真实场景,提供详尽的解释和解决方案。无论您是初学者还是资深用户,都能从中找到实用建议,避免常见陷阱。
数据格式不正确导致求和失败数据格式问题是导致自动求和功能失效的常见原因之一。如果单元格被设置为文本格式,而非数字格式,Excel将无法识别其中的数值,从而在求和时返回零或错误结果。例如,用户输入了一列销售额数据,但由于格式错误,数字被当作文本处理,自动求和公式显示为零。另一个案例是,从外部系统导入数据时,数字可能带有隐藏的文本属性,导致求和功能无法正常执行。根据微软官方支持文档,正确设置单元格格式为“数字”或“常规”,可以避免此类问题。
单元格包含非数字字符当单元格中包含空格、字母或其他非数字字符时,自动求和功能会受到影响。Excel只能对纯数字数据进行计算,如果数据中混入无关字符,求和结果将不准确。例如,用户在输入价格时添加了单位如“100元”,导致Excel无法将其识别为数字,求和时返回错误。另一个常见案例是,数据清理不彻底,遗留了隐藏符号,如制表符或换行符,干扰了自动求和的执行。通过使用“查找和替换”功能清除非数字元素,可以有效解决这一问题。
自动求和功能区域选择限制自动求和功能通常只对连续的数字区域有效,如果用户选择了不连续的单元格或包含空格的区域,功能可能无法正确应用。例如,用户试图对A列和C列的数字求和,但未选中连续范围,导致自动求和按钮灰色不可用。另一个案例是,在包含合并单元格的工作表中,自动求和可能忽略部分数据,因为合并单元格破坏了数据的连续性。微软官方指南建议,在求和前确保选择完整的数字区域,并使用“SUM”函数手动验证,以提高准确性。
用户输入公式错误手动输入公式时的错误是另一个常见原因,例如公式语法不正确或引用范围错误,会导致自动求和功能失效。例如,用户输入“=SUM(A1)”而不是“=SUM(A1:A10)”,仅对单个单元格求和,而忽略了整个数据范围。另一个案例是,公式中使用了错误的运算符,如将加号误写为减号,导致计算结果偏差。根据微软帮助中心,使用公式审核工具检查错误,并参考官方函数库,可以避免此类问题。
软件计算选项设置为手动Excel的计算选项如果设置为手动模式,公式不会自动更新,这会导致自动求和结果显示旧值或根本不计算。例如,用户在处理大型数据集时,为提升性能而将计算改为手动,但忘记重新计算,求和结果便停滞不前。另一个案例是,在共享工作簿中,其他用户修改了设置,导致自动求和功能暂停。微软官方文档指出,在“文件”选项中的“公式”设置里,将计算模式改为自动,可以确保求和实时更新。
Excel版本差异影响功能不同版本的Excel软件可能在功能实现上存在差异,旧版本可能缺少某些自动求和的相关特性,导致功能不兼容。例如,在Excel 2007中,自动求和可能对某些数组公式支持不足,而在较新版本如Excel 365中则得到改进。另一个案例是,跨平台使用(如从Windows切换到Mac)时,界面和功能略有不同,用户可能不熟悉新版本的自动求和操作。参考微软版本发布说明,升级到最新版或学习特定版本的使用方法,可以缓解这一问题。
文件权限和保護设置如果工作簿受到保护或用户权限受限,自动求和功能可能无法编辑或执行。例如,在共享环境中,文件被设置为只读模式,用户无法修改公式,导致求和失败。另一个案例是,管理员设置了单元格保护,防止未授权更改,自动求和按钮因此不可用。根据微软安全指南,解除保护或获取相应权限后,功能即可恢复正常。
宏和插件干扰自动功能自定义宏或第三方插件有时会覆盖Excel的标准功能,包括自动求和,导致其行为异常。例如,用户安装了一个用于数据处理的插件,该插件修改了计算逻辑,使自动求和返回错误值。另一个案例是,宏脚本中包含了禁用自动计算的代码,用户运行后求和功能暂停。微软开发文档建议,检查并禁用冲突的宏或插件,或使用安全模式启动Excel以排除干扰。
数据验证规则阻止计算数据验证规则如果设置不当,可能会阻止单元格参与计算,从而影响自动求和。例如,用户定义了验证规则只允许输入特定范围的数字,但实际数据超出范围,导致求和时忽略这些单元格。另一个案例是,验证规则与公式冲突,使自动求和无法执行。通过审核数据验证设置,并调整规则以兼容计算需求,可以解决此问题。
隐藏行或列中的数据未被包含自动求和功能默认只对可见单元格进行计算,如果隐藏行或列中包含数字,这些数据可能被忽略,导致求和结果不完整。例如,用户隐藏了部分行以简化视图,但忘记这些行中有重要数值,自动求和时未计入。另一个案例是,使用筛选功能后,隐藏的数据未被包含在求和范围内。微软官方教程提示,在求和前取消隐藏或使用“SUBTOTAL”函数,可以确保所有数据被正确计算。
外部链接断开导致公式错误如果求和公式引用了外部工作簿或数据源,而链接断开或文件丢失,自动求和将返回错误值。例如,用户从另一个Excel文件引用了数据,但该文件被移动或删除,导致求和功能失效。另一个案例是,网络路径变更,使外部链接无法访问。根据微软支持文章,更新链接路径或将数据导入当前工作簿,可以避免此类问题。
缓存和显示问题Excel的缓存机制有时会导致显示值与实际值不一致,自动求和结果可能基于旧缓存数据,而非最新输入。例如,用户修改了数字后,求和结果未立即更新,因为缓存未刷新。另一个案例是,在低性能设备上,缓存延迟更明显,影响自动求和的实时性。微软性能优化指南建议,手动刷新计算或清除缓存,以确保准确性。
大数据集性能延迟处理大型数据集时,Excel可能因性能限制而延迟计算,自动求和功能响应缓慢或暂时无效。例如,用户在工作表中输入了数万行数据,自动求和在后台计算需时较长,用户误以为功能失效。另一个案例是,复杂公式组合加剧了性能负担,导致求和结果迟迟不显示。通过优化数据结构和减少不必要的公式,可以提升计算效率。
操作系统兼容性问题Excel在不同操作系统上的行为可能略有差异,例如在Windows和Mac平台上,自动求和功能的界面或默认设置不同,导致用户困惑。例如,Mac版Excel的自动求和按钮位置与Windows版不同,用户可能找不到该功能。另一个案例是,操作系统更新后,与Excel的兼容性出现问题,影响求和计算。参考微软跨平台指南,适应特定系统的操作方式,可以减少此类问题。
数字自定义格式误解自定义数字格式,如将数字显示为日期或货币,可能导致用户误解数据本质,进而影响自动求和。例如,单元格实际存储的是数字,但格式设置为日期显示,自动求和时Excel可能错误处理。另一个案例是,自定义格式添加了前缀或后缀,使数字在视觉上变形,但求和功能仍基于原始值。确保格式与数据类型匹配,可以避免混淆。
错误值在数据中传播如果数据范围内包含错误值,如“DIV/0!”或“N/A”,自动求和可能返回错误或忽略整个范围。例如,一个单元格因除以零而显示错误,导致求和公式无法执行。另一个案例是,错误值通过公式链传播,影响多个单元格的求和结果。使用“IFERROR”函数处理错误值,或手动修正数据源,可以恢复求和功能。
数组公式使用不当数组公式如果未正确输入或与自动求和功能冲突,可能导致求和失败。例如,用户尝试对数组公式结果求和,但未使用适当的大括号或函数组合,使计算无效。另一个案例是,数组公式范围与自动求和区域重叠,引发计算错误。学习数组公式的基本规则,并参考微软公式库,可以确保兼容性。
自动保存和备份影响自动保存或备份功能有时会干扰公式的实时更新,导致自动求和结果显示不及时。例如,在云存储环境中,自动保存过程暂停了计算,用户看到的是未更新的求和值。另一个案例是,备份文件恢复后,公式链接断裂,影响求和功能。调整保存设置或手动触发计算,可以缓解这一问题。
综上所述,Excel不自动求和的原因多样,涉及数据格式、软件设置、用户操作等多方面因素。通过系统排查这些常见问题,并参考官方资源,用户可以高效解决求和故障,提升工作效率。本文提供的案例和建议,旨在帮助读者从源头预防问题,确保数据处理的准确性和流畅性。




